Effects of gallium chloride on changes in action potentials and contraction in guinea pig ventricular muscle. 1996

J P Kantelip, and H Millart, and A Leperre, and F Mougin, and J M Didier
Laboratorie de Pharmacologie Fondamentale, Faculté de Médecine, Besançon, France.

The electrophysiological effects of gallium chloride (Ga ) and its activity on arrhythmias induced by digitalis were investigated in guinea pig papillary muscle. KCl microelectrodes were used to record transmembrane electrical activity from Purkinje cells from the papillary muscle of guinea pig hearts during superfusion and electrical stimulation in vitro at 37 degrees C. Myocardial contractility was continuously monitored. Ga was superfused alone in cumulative concentrations(4.5 . 10(-5) to 3.6 . 10(-4) M). Arrhythmias were induced by a superfusion of Digitoxin (7.5 . 10 (-7) M). A superfusion of Ga (4.5 . 10(-5), 9 . 10(-5), 1.8 . 10(-4) M and 3.6 . 10(-4) M) was started 20 min later and maintained for 70 min. Ga alone produced a dose dependent reduction of action potential duration and contractility. Ga potentiated the decrease in the amplitude and duration of the action potential induced by Digitoxin. The incidence of arrhythmias was immediately reduced by two concentrations of Ga (4.5 . 10(-5) and 9 . 10(-5) M) in the digitalized papillary muscles. It is concluded that Ga inhibits calcium movements and has negative inotropic and antidysrhythmic effects.

D008564 Membrane Potentials The voltage differences across a membrane. For cellular membranes they are computed by subtracting the voltage measured outside the membrane from the voltage measured inside the membrane. They result from differences of inside versus outside concentration of potassium, sodium, chloride, and other ions across cells' or ORGANELLES membranes. For excitable cells, the resting membrane potentials range between -30 and -100 millivolts. Physical, chemical, or electrical stimuli can make a membrane potential more negative (hyperpolarization), or less negative (depolarization). D004072 Digitonin A glycoside obtained from Digitalis purpurea; the aglycone is digitogenin which is bound to five sugars. Digitonin solubilizes lipids, especially in membranes and is used as a tool in cellular biochemistry, and reagent for precipitating cholesterol. It has no cardiac effects. Digitin
